About Georges Orfanoudakis

Georges Orfanoudakis is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Hepatology and Immunology, having authored 27 papers that have together received 605 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(10 papers), Cervical Cancer and HPV Research (7 papers) and Hepatitis B Virus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Epidemiology (259 citations), Hepatology (47 citations) and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(115 citations). Georges Orfanoudakis has collaborated with scholars based in France, Greece and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Étienne Weiss, Gilles Travé, Murielle Masson, François Deryckère, Sébastian Charbonnier, Yves Nominé, Bruno Kieffer, Tutik Ristriani, Annie‐Paule Sibler and Katia Zanier. Their work appears in journals such as Molecular Cell, PLoS ONE and Molecular and Cellular Biology.
